    The evaluation of the oral health-related quality of life (OHRQoL) is important for clinical assessment and could be an indicator of the quality of the treatment received. Objective: To evaluate the OHRQoL in adults with removable prostheses in relation with patient characteristics such as age, sex, type and time of use of the prosthesis, previous experience and perception about the stability of the prosthesis. Materials and Methods: 217 patients from the Dental Clinic of the National University of San Marcos-Peru were evaluated after rehabilitation with a removable prosthesis. A structured questionnaire was applied by telephone interview. The evaluation of the OHRQoL was carried out using the General/Geriatric Oral Health Evaluation Index (GOHAI). For the statistical analysis, the Mann Whitney U test, the Kruskal-Wallis H test and the Spearman correlation were used. Results: The sample included 63 men (29%) and 154 women (71%) with an average age of 66.34. The average GOHAI score was 52.44+8.15. The GOHAI score was related to age (p=0.241), sex (p=0.110), type of prosthesis (p=0.069), previous experience (p=0.293), and perception of movement of the prosthesis (p<0.001). Conclusions: The GOHAI score indicates a moderate quality of life related to oral health after prosthetic rehabilitation.     The nuclear spin temperature, which is derived from the ortho-to-para abundance ratio of molecules measured in cometary comae, is a clue to the formation conditions of cometary materials, especially the physical temperature at which the molecules were formed. In this paper we present new results for the nuclear spin temperatures of ammonia in comets Hale-Bopp (C/1995 O1) and 153P/Ikeya-Zhang based on observations of NH2 at 26 and 32 K, respectively. These results are similar to previous measurements in two other comets, and the nuclear spin temperatures of ammonia in the four comets are concentrated at about 30 K. We emphasize that the nuclear spin temperatures of water measured thus far have also been about 30 K. In particular, the spin temperatures of ammonia and water are equal to each other within ±1 σ error bars in the case of comet Hale-Bopp. These nuclear spin temperatures of ammonia and water were measured under quite different conditions (heliocentric distances and gas production rates). There is no clear trend between the nuclear spin temperatures and the heliocentric distances, the gas production rates, or the orbital periods of the comets. The possibilities of the ortho-to-para conversion in the coma and in the nucleus are discussed. The present data set implies that the ortho-to-para ratios were not altered after the molecules were incorporated into the cometary nuclei. It appears that cometary ammonia and water molecules formed on cold grains at about 30 K

    Tissue Localization and Extracellular Matrix Degradation by PI, PII and PIII Snake Venom Metalloproteinases: Clues on the Mechanisms of Venom-Induced Hemorrhage

    Get PDF
    20 páginas, 4 figuras, 3 tablas y 7 tablas en material suplementario.Snake venom hemorrhagic metalloproteinases (SVMPs) of the PI, PII and PIII classes were compared in terms of tissue localization and their ability to hydrolyze basement membrane components in vivo, as well as by a proteomics analysis of exudates collected in tissue injected with these enzymes. Immunohistochemical analyses of co-localization of these SVMPs with type IV collagen revealed that PII and PIII enzymes co-localized with type IV collagen in capillaries, arterioles and post-capillary venules to a higher extent than PI SVMP, which showed a more widespread distribution in the tissue. The patterns of hydrolysis by these three SVMPs of laminin, type VI collagen and nidogen in vivo greatly differ, whereas the three enzymes showed a similar pattern of degradation of type IV collagen, supporting the concept that hydrolysis of this component is critical for the destabilization of microvessel structure leading to hemorrhage. Proteomic analysis of wound exudate revealed similarities and differences between the action of the three SVMPs. Higher extent of proteolysis was observed for the PI enzyme regarding several extracellular matrix components and fibrinogen, whereas exudates from mice injected with PII and PIII SVMPs had higher amounts of some intracellular proteins.     Association of hepatitis B virus infection status with outcomes of non-small cell lung cancer patients undergoing anti-PD-1/PD-L1 therapy

    Get PDF
    Background: The aim of this study was to evaluate the safety and survival outcomes of anti-programmed cell death (PD)-1/programmed cell death-ligand 1 (PD-L1) monotherapy in patients with advanced nonsmall cell lung cancer (NSCLC) and different hepatitis B virus (HBV) infection status. Methods: Patients with advanced NSCLC and both chronic and/or resolved HBV infection who were treated with anti-PD-(L)1 monotherapy were retrospectively enrolled. The primary endpoint was the safety of PD-1/PD-L1 monotherapy, while the secondary endpoints included the survival outcomes. Results: Of the 62 eligible patients, 10 (16.1%) were hepatitis B surface antigen (HBsAg) positive [chronic hepatitis B (CHB) infection] and 52 (83.9%) were HBsAg negative and HBcAb positive [resolved hepatitis B (RHB) infection]; 42 (67.7%) patients had at least 1 treatment-related adverse event (AE), with 4 patients (6.5%) developing grade 3 AEs and 6 (9.7%) developing hepatic AEs. One CHB patient experienced HBV reactivation during anti-PD-1 immunotherapy due to the interruption of antiviral prophylaxis. The objective response rate and durable clinical benefit (DCB) rate were 17.7% and 29.0%, respectively. Median overall survival (OS) and progression-free survival (PFS) were 23.6 months [95% confidence interval (CI): 14.432.8] and 2.1 months (95% CI: 1.2-3.0), respectively. The DCB rate was significantly higher in the CHB group than in the RHB group (60% vs. 23.1%; P=0.048). Patients with CHB experienced a longer PFS (8.3 vs. 2.0 months; P=0.103) and OS (35.0 vs. 18.2 months, P=0.119) than did RHB patients. Conclusions: Anti-PD-(L)1 monotherapy was safe and effective in patients with NSCLC and HBV infection. This population should not be excluded from receiving immunotherapy in routine clinical practice or within clinical trials if HBV biomarkers are monitored and antiviral prophylaxis is properly used

    Developmental regulation of tau splicing is disrupted in stem cell-derived neurons from frontotemporal dementia patients with the 10 + 16 splice-site mutation in MAPT

    Get PDF
    The alternative splicing of the tau gene, MAPT, generates six protein isoforms in the adult human CNS. Tau splicing is developmentally regulated and dysregulated in disease. Mutations in MAPT that alter tau splicing cause frontotemporal dementia (FTD) with tau pathology, providing evidence for a causal link between altered tau splicing and disease. The use of induced pluripotent stem cell (iPSC) derived neurons has revolutionized the way we model neurological disease in vitro. However, as most tau mutations are located within or around the alternatively spliced exon 10, it is important that iPSC-neurons splice tau appropriately in order to be used as disease models. To address this issue, we analysed the expression, and splicing of tau in iPSC-derived cortical neurons from control patients and FTD patients with the 10+16 intronic mutation in MAPT. We show that control neurons only express the fetal tau isoform (0N3R), even at extended time points of 100 days in vitro. Neurons from FTD patients with the 10+16 mutation in MAPT express both 0N3R and 0N4R tau isoforms, demonstrating that this mutation overrides the developmental regulation of exon 10 inclusion in our in vitro model. Further, at extended time-points of 365 days in vitro, we observe a switch in tau splicing to include six tau isoforms as seen the adult human CNS. Our results demonstrate the importance of neuronal maturity for use in in vitro modeling and provide a system that will be important for understanding the functional consequences of altered tau splicing

    A discontinuous DNA glycosylase domain in a family of enzymes that excise 5-methylcytosine

    Get PDF
    DNA cytosine methylation (5-meC) is a widespread epigenetic mark associated to gene silencing. In plants, DEMETER-LIKE (DML) proteins typified by Arabidopsis REPRESSOR OF SILENCING 1 (ROS1) initiate active DNA demethylation by catalyzing 5-meC excision. DML proteins belong to the HhH-GPD superfamily, the largest and most functionally diverse group of DNA glycosylases, but the molecular properties that underlie their capacity to specifically recognize and excise 5-meC are largely unknown. We have found that sequence similarity to HhH-GPD enzymes in DML proteins is actually distributed over two non-contiguous segments connected by a predicted disordered region. We used homology-based modeling to locate candidate residues important for ROS1 function in both segments, and tested our predictions by site-specific mutagenesis. We found that amino acids T606 and D611 are essential for ROS1 DNA glycosylase activity, whereas mutations in either of two aromatic residues (F589 and Y1028) reverse the characteristic ROS1 preference for 5-meC over T. We also found evidence suggesting that ROS1 uses Q607 to flip out 5-meC, while the contiguous N608 residue contributes to sequence-context specificity. In addition to providing novel insights into the molecular basis of 5-meC excision, our results reveal that ROS1 and its DML homologs possess a discontinuous catalytic domain that is unprecedented among known DNA glycosylases

A total of 180 Hisex White hens were randomly distributed in six treatments, with five replicates of six birds. The treatments consisted of: ration without antioxidant; ration with 200 ppm butylated hydroxytoluene (BHT); ration with 200 or 400 ppm of mango peel extract (Ecas); and ration with 200 or 400 ppm of mango seed extract (Ecar). Feed intake, egg production, egg weight, produced egg mass (gram by bird per day), feed conversion, and egg quality were evaluated. Yolk lipid oxidation during storage was determined by quantification of thiobarbituric acid‑reactive substances. Birds fed diet without antioxidants produced eggs with the lowest Haugh unit values and the highest lipid oxidation of yolk. Ecas at 400 ppm and Ecar at 200 or 400 ppm were effective to prevent oxidative damage of eggs during storage and may be used in the diet of laying hens as a replacement for synthetic antioxidant
